What is Quilt?
Quilt is a cloud-based AI platform for proposal, presales, and security teams that automates questionnaire responses and provides a connected knowledge assistant. It helps teams answer RFPs, RFIs, DDQs, and security questionnaires using synced source content across web, Chrome, Slack, and Google Workspace workflows. Note: Quilt has merged with Rox as of 2026.

Capabilities
4 AI-poweredAI Generation
Generates first-draft answers for RFPs, DDQs, and security questionnaires from connected organizational knowledge.
Summarizes lengthy responses into concise formats for faster review.
Knowledge Management
Connects to source systems and stays current without manual content curation.
Answers questions across organizational content in natural language via chat.
Extracts and stores knowledge from meetings via Zoom, Chorus, and Gong integrations.
Quality & Verification
Displays ranked source references behind each answer so reviewers can verify provenance.
Delivery & Access
Supports answering via web app, Chrome extension autofill, Slack, and Google Sheets.

Who is Quilt best for?
High-volume RFP, RFI, and DDQ response with AI-assisted drafting for proposal and presales teams
Security questionnaire completion using existing source documents such as SOC 2 reports
Team-wide knowledge access in Slack, Chrome, and Google Workspace for fast technical and sales responses
- DeploymentNo on-premise deployment or non-US data residency
- TechnicalNo public APIs
- PricingNo transparent paid-seat pricing
Competitive Overview
- Fast first-pass completion for questionnaires and security forms
- Flexible usage across web, Chrome, Slack, Google Sheets, and vendor portals
- Knowledge-base and questionnaire workflows combined in one product
- Free tier with 20 questionnaires/month — accessible entry point
- Public paid pricing opaque beyond free tier
- No public API documentation
- Rox merger creates uncertainty — buyers may hesitate if product direction is unclear
- No CRM integrations (Salesforce, HubSpot) documented
